What does the 2014 Native American dollar look like?

The 2014 dollar depicts a Native American man clasping a ceremonial pipe while his wife holds a plate of provisions, including fish, corn, roots and gourds. In the background is the stylized image of the face of William Clark’s compass, displaying “NW” for “northwest.”.

When did they start sending US dollar coins to stores?

Beginning in January 2000, the Mint began sending dollar coins to Wal-Mart and Sam’s Club stores across the United States in order to help promote and circulate the coins. In total, $100 million worth of the dollars were shipped to the stores as part of the promotion.

What was the purpose of the Native American dollar?

These coins are marketed as ” Native American dollars “. The coin was introduced as a replacement for the Susan B. Anthony dollar, which proved useful for vending machine operators and mass transit systems despite being unpopular with the public.

When was the first one dollar coin made?

Here are some quick facts that collectors might find of interest: -The legal authorization to mint a new dollar coin was passed in 1997, but the first coins were not released until January 2000. -The general public actually preferred a coin showing the statue of liberty, but the Sacagawea design was selected by the officials in charge of the coin.
